BETONIM

(Betʹo·nim) [Pistachio Nuts].

A city E of the Jordan that Moses gave as “a gift” to the tribe of Gad. (Jos 13:24-27) Betonim is generally held to be the present-day Khirbet Batneh in the mountainous country 21 km (13 mi) W of Rabbah (in Ammon).
